Hello

I just had surgery on Monday.  It was uneventful.  I came back up to my room and was pretty out of it the whole day.  I could barely stay awake.  I felt some pain in my abdomen but didn't even need to use pain med thanks to the abundance of anesthesia on board.  They get you right up and walking.  It just keeps getting easier (pain, gas) .  Today I felt pretty good, I took in the most fluid so far but still no where near the 64 oz the want.  Thats okay though as long as I keep trying my NUT said I will get there. 

Personally, I keep focusing on the end result.  I'm not letting myself obsess about food, I just got stocked up with what I am allowed and I taking as much of that as I can.   Good luck tomorrow and try to get some rest....I hope all goes well.
